2. How do you ensure consistent acoustic performance across production batches?
We implement:
- In-line acoustic testing: Every windshield undergoes laser vibrometry testing to verify STC/OITC values
- Interlayer traceability: Each acoustic film batch is barcoded and tested for damping properties
- Statistical process control: Real-time monitoring of lamination parameters (temperature, pressure, time)
Our defect rate is <0.1% for acoustic performance, verified by third-party audits.
